Наши проекты:
Журнал · Discuz!ML · Wiki · DRKB · Помощь проекту |
||
ПРАВИЛА | FAQ | Помощь | Поиск | Участники | Календарь | Избранное | RSS |
[18.97.9.173] |
|
Сообщ.
#1
,
|
|
|
Я думаю все знакомы с тригонометрическими функиями, такими как синус, косинус и т.д.
Так вот, мне нужно в программе получить синус определенного угла и когда я пишу команду (sin(30) например), по идее должен быть ответ - 0.5, а в результате получается что-т типа -0,988031624092862 Кто-нибудь, плиз, поясните в чём дело, может я чего-то не понимаю или не туда пишу ? |
Сообщ.
#2
,
|
|
|
Угол нужно задавать в радианах! Чтобы перевести градусы в радианы юзай формулу Угол(в радианах) = угол(в градусах) * pi/180, где pi=3.14159265358979
|
Сообщ.
#3
,
|
|
|
miksayer, большое спасибо.
|